当前位置:首页 > 建站教程 > 正文

PHP制作网页,高效便捷的网站开发解决方案

PHP制作网页,高效便捷的网站开发解决方案

在当今互联网时代,网站已成为企业、个人展示形象、传播信息的重要平台,而PHP作为一门流行的服务器端脚本语言,因其强大的功能、易学易用等特点,成为许多网站开发者的首选,本...

在当今互联网时代,网站已成为企业、个人展示形象、传播信息的重要平台,而PHP作为一门流行的服务器端脚本语言,因其强大的功能、易学易用等特点,成为许多网站开发者的首选,本文将详细介绍PHP制作网页的过程,帮助您轻松掌握这一技能。

PHP简介

PHP(Hypertext Preprocessor)是一种开源的、跨平台的服务器端脚本语言,由拉斯姆斯·勒德·努尔利(Rasmus Lerdorf)在1994年发明,PHP与HTML语言紧密集成,可以在网页中直接嵌入PHP代码,实现动态网页功能,PHP支持多种数据库,如MySQL、SQLite等,可以方便地实现数据存储和查询。

PHP制作网页的步骤

1、安装PHP环境

您需要在您的计算机上安装PHP环境,您可以选择下载PHP安装包,或者使用集成开发环境(IDE)如WAMP、XAMPP等,这些IDE集成了PHP、MySQL、Apache等软件,可以快速搭建开发环境。

2、创建HTML页面

使用HTML语言创建网页的基本结构,包括标题、段落、图片等元素,在HTML页面中,您可以添加PHP代码,实现动态效果

3、编写PHP代码

在HTML页面中,您可以使用PHP标签<?php ... ?>嵌入PHP代码,以下是一些常用的PHP代码示例:

(1)变量赋值与输出

<?php
$a = 10;
$b = 20;
echo "The sum of a and b is: " . ($a + $b);
?>

(2)条件语句

<?php
if ($a > $b) {
    echo "a is greater than b";
} else {
    echo "b is greater than a";
}
?>

(3)循环语句

<?php
for ($i = 0; $i < 10; $i++) {
    echo $i . "<br>";
}
?>

4、配置数据库连接

在PHP项目中,您需要连接数据库以实现数据存储和查询,以下是一个使用MySQL数据库的示例:

<?php
$servername = "localhost";
$username = "root";
$password = "";
$dbname = "test";
// 创建连接
$conn = new mysqli($servername, $username, $password, $dbname);
// 检测连接
if ($conn->connect_error) {
    die("Connection failed: " . $conn->connect_error);
}
?>

5、实现动态网页功能

在PHP代码中,您可以读取数据库数据,并根据数据动态生成HTML内容,以下是一个简单的示例:

<?php
$sql = "SELECT id, firstname, lastname FROM MyGuests";
$result = $conn->query($sql);
if ($result->num_rows > 0) {
    // 输出数据
    while($row = $result->fetch_assoc()) {
        echo "id: " . $row["id"]. " - Name: " . $row["firstname"]. " " . $row["lastname"]. "<br>";
    }
} else {
    echo "0 results";
}
$conn->close();
?>

6、部署网站

完成网页开发后,您需要将网站部署到服务器上,您可以选择使用虚拟主机、云服务器等方式,将网站上传到服务器,并配置相应的域名和端口。

PHP制作网页是一种高效、便捷的网站开发解决方案,通过本文的介绍,您已经掌握了PHP制作网页的基本步骤,在实际开发过程中,您可以根据项目需求,不断学习新的PHP技术和框架,提高网站开发效率,祝您在网站开发的道路上越走越远!

    最新文章